5 - Settings

The X-Eye Gender sensor has multiple settings which determine the behaviour and output of the sensor. The settings can be 
adjusted by sending X-talk setting commands via the API. After a power cycle, the settings always return to back to default.

X is a value between 

1-100

 and it's default value is 

1

This value can be used to change the vertical range of 

the visual canvas of the sensor. The canvas is defined as 

1-100. When increasing X, the sensor will block an area on 

the topside of its field of view. For example, when setting 

X to 15, the sensor will only detect people between the 
vertical range of 15-100.

X is a value between 

1-100

 and it's default value is 

100

This value can be used to change the vertical range of 

the visual canvas of the sensor. The canvas is defined as 

1-100. When decreasing X, the sensor will block an area 

on the bottom side of its field of view. For example, when 

setting X to 70, the sensor will only detect people between 
the vertical range of 1-70.
